Taylor Swift’s “All Too Well” Re-recorded Version Surpasses the Original.
Taylor Swift’s ALL Too Well has long been admired as one of the most touching tracks. “All Too Well" narrates a failed romantic relationship, recalling the intimate memories and exploring the painful aftermath. Nearly a decade after the original release, Swift released the 10-minute version. This extended cut revealed layers of depth emotion, and pain that were left untapped in the original.
The original All Too Well was a five-minute power ballad blending country, folk, and rock elements. The song recounts a fallen relationship that happened in the fall. The song starts with the trip of two ex-lovers to upstate. When the narrator visits the ex-lover’s sister’s house, she leaves her scarf. The narrator then recalls the intimate moments with her ex-lover ("There we are again in the middle of the night/ We dance around the kitchen in the refrigerator light"). The bridge, featuring the line "You call me up again just to break me like a promise / So casually cruel in the name of being honest," remains one of Swift’s most iconic, where the track reaches its climax.
Despite being one of the standout tracks on Red, the original All Too Well was trimmed from what Swift later revealed to be an even more extensive version of the song. She reveals that the song was originally much longer, with Swift and Rose working to condense it down for the album.
She talked some more about writing All Too Well in an interview with Country Weekly: "It's about this relationship that I had, and it tells the story of it from start to finish, so it's all these pieces of memories, one by one, listed off. It's one of the most vivid pictures that I've ever gotten to paint with a song,"
In 2021, when Swift released Red (Taylor's Version), the 10-minute version of All Too Well emerged as a centerpiece of her musical reclamation. Produced by Swift and Jack Antonoff, this longer version featured atmospheric pop-rock elements that helped amplify the song’s emotional depth. She gave this extended version to her listeners, who were eager to listen for a long time. The new verses and lyrics provide richer context, delving further into the painful dissolution of the relationship. The 10-minute version takes listeners on a more detailed journey through heartbreak, anger, and eventual acceptance of relationships.
Lyrics like "And you were tossing me the car keys, ‘fuck the patriarchy’ keychain on the ground" expand on the political and personal undertones of the breakup, turning the song into a more textured narrative. This version of All Too Well doesn’t just recall memories — it unpacks them in a raw and therapeutic way. Swift’s vocal performance, which shifts from soft introspection to full-bodied exclamation, helps deliver these lines with the intensity they deserve and keeps engaging. Why the Re-Recorded Version Surpasses the Original
While the original All Too Well was already celebrated as a career-defining song for Swift, the 10-minute version builds upon that foundation, offering more clarity, depth, and emotional complexity, which took the song to a new height again. The re-recorded version feels like a fully realized masterpiece, made even more impactful with the short film's release in the direction of Taylor's Swift. In many ways, the song’s longer version allows Swift to tell the story she always intended without the restrictions of time or commercial considerations, which also allows the listeners to know how relationship slowly fades up with the same argument and bad times no matter strong their bond is. By reclaiming her music and revisiting one of her most beloved songs, Swift has transformed All Too Well from a deeply personal ballad into a timeless anthem of heartbreak, growth, and empowerment.
